Fan ovens

Fan ovens are usually called convection ovens. They are equipped with fans that circulate hot air inside the oven cavity. This helps to ensure even cooking across the food, eliminating hot or cold spots. Because of this, they can help to reduce cooking times as compared to conventional ovens. However, it's still essential to follow the recommended cooking time and temperatures for best results.

The fan can also come in handy when using the oven to defrost food items because it permits you to set a temperature low to gently warm food without damaging its texture or taste. It is also useful to roast meats or vegetables because it can help achieve an even, golden appearance by circulating heat around the food.

When baking, a fan oven can help to produce a better rise and more consistent browning than a conventional oven, which is particularly important when making breads or cakes. It is crucial to remember that fan ovens cook food quicker than conventional ovens. Therefore, you must examine your recipes and observe the oven until you are familiar with its capabilities.

In addition to their capacity to bake and roast in general, they can be used for a variety of other cooking methods, including grilling. This versatility makes them a great choice to anyone looking for a multi-purpose oven that is cost-effective and easy to use.

The heating system of a fan oven can also be beneficial in preheating food as it helps to warm the oven more quickly than a conventional oven, which could help you save time in the kitchen. It is important to keep in mind that when you are preheating your oven with the fan on it is possible to reduce the temperature of the oven by as much as 20 degrees Celsius to account for the more efficient distribution of heat.

A majority of fan ovens are easier to clean than conventional models because they are less prone to accumulating grime. They're usually also easier to clean, so you can keep them looking like new with minimal effort.

Conventional ovens

Conventional ovens feature heating elements with electric power at the top and the bottom of the oven, which heat the air to cook foods. This kind of oven is available at a variety of price ranges and is the most common in kitchens that are used by families. These ovens typically have the traditional cooking mode as well as a fan-assisted and grill function. Conventional ovens cost less than convection and combination ovens. They also provide precise temperature control, which means your meals will come out exactly the way you like.

Traditional ovens are perfect for baking a variety of foods from bread made of yeast to hearty casseroles. They cook quickly and evenly, making them ideal for large family dinners. However conventional ovens aren't designed to bake delicate items like cakes and they can leave hotter or colder spots in the middle of the cake. This is because the hot air rises, leaving these areas unattended by the fan.

To avoid this issue It is recommended to select a conventional oven with a fan-assisted cooking setting. This type of oven uses electric elements at the top and bottom for heating the air. It also circulates the air with a fan, ensuring that the baked goods are cooked evenly. Conventional ovens are also suited for a variety of other cooking methods, like broiling and roasting.
